#1d0953 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d0953 is composed of 11.4% red, 3.5% green and 32.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65.1% cyan, 89.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.5% black. It has a hue angle of 256.2 degrees, a saturation of 80.4% and a lightness of 18%. #1d0953 color hex could be obtained by blending #3a12a6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

● #1d0953 color description : Very dark violet.
#1d0953 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1d0953 has RGB values of R:29, G:9, B:83 and CMYK values of C:0.65, M:0.89, Y:0,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 1902931.
